Process Principle and Advantages
Through the advanced nano alloy technology, we carefully create a nano-scale alloy coating on the surface of the picks. This special coating incorporates numerous outstanding properties:
Ultra-High Hardness for Wear and Tear Resistance: The nano alloy particles are evenly and densely distributed in the coating, significantly increasing its hardness compared to traditional pick materials. During actual drilling operations, when facing various soils and rocks, especially hard rocks, this coating acts like a solid armor, effectively resisting wear and tear and greatly extending the service life of the picks. For example, after numerous on-site tests and comparisons, picks manufactured with the nano alloy technology, under the same drilling conditions in hard rock formations, exhibit a wear reduction of over [X]% compared to ordinary picks. This significantly reduces the labor, material costs, and construction time wasted due to frequent pick replacements, greatly improving construction efficiency and economic benefits.Outstanding Corrosion Resistance for Adaptation to Diverse Environments: Construction sites often have complex and variable environments, which may include factors such as humidity and strata containing corrosive substances. Our nano alloy coating has excellent corrosion resistance and serves as a tight protective barrier that can effectively isolate external corrosive media. This ensures that the picks can maintain good performance over long periods of operation in any harsh environment, reducing the risk of performance degradation and failures caused by corrosion and further ensuring the continuity and reliability of construction.Good Thermal Stability for Continuous Operation: During the long-term and high-intensity drilling process of rotary drilling rigs, intense friction between the picks and the strata generates a large amount of heat. Thanks to the excellent thermal stability of the nano alloy coating, it will not soften or deform even under high-temperature conditions, still stably performing its cutting and wear-resistant functions, ensuring the uninterrupted progress of construction and enabling your rotary drilling rigs to continuously and efficiently complete drilling tasks.
